In eukaryotic cells chromosomes are found within the nucleus. The only exception to this is during mitosis (i.e. cell division) when the nuclear membrane disappears and the chromosomes line up at the metaphase plate and then move towards opposite direction in anaphase. Reaching the telophase these are again surrounded by the nuclear envelop.

Where is the DNA in the prokaryote in the eukaryote?

In a prokaryote cell the DNA is located just within the cell, floating in the cytoplasm, whereas the DNA in eukaryote cells is located inside the nucleus.

Where are the chromosomes of most organisms located?

In prokaryotic cells, the chromosome is attached to the cell membrane and is a single plasmid. In eukaryotic cells the (usually multiple) chromosomes are enclosed within the nucleus.
